HC Deb 15 July 1986 vol 101 c494W
37. Mr. Kennedy

asked the Secretary of State for Defence what account his Department took of public safety considerations when awarding the contract for the road transportation of formaldehyde to be used in the decontamination of Gruinard island; and if he will make a statement.

Mr. Lee

In selecting a prime contractor for the task of decontaminating Gruinard island the Ministry of Defence took full account of safety considerations, including the proposed methods of handling formaldehyde. The Ministry was not, however, involved in the prime contractor's selection of a sub-contractor to transport the formaldehyde to Gruinard island.
